#514918 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#514918 is composed of 31.8% red, 28.6% green and 9.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 9.9% magenta, 70.4% yellow and 68.2% black. It has a hue angle of 51.6 degrees, a saturation of 54.3% and a lightness of 20.6%. #514918 color hex could be obtained by blending #a29230 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663300.

Shades and Tints of #514918

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050502 is the darkest color, while #fcfbf5 is the lightest one.
